Loral Space & Communications Inc

TO:LORL Canada Household & Personal Products
Market Cap
$9.61 Billion
CA$13.81 Billion CAD
Market Cap Rank
#2936 Global
#7 in Canada
Share Price
CA$25.87
Change (1 day)
+0.00%
52-Week Range
CA$24.13 - CA$25.87
All Time High
CA$25.87
About

L'Oréal S.A., through its subsidiaries, manufactures and sells cosmetic products for women and men worldwide. The company operates through four divisions: Professional Products, Consumer Products, Luxe, and Dermatological Beauty. It offers skincare, make-up, hair colourants, haircare, perfumes, and hygiene products. The company provides its products under the L'Oréal Paris, Garnier, Maybelline Ne… Read more

Market Cap & Net Worth: Loral Space & Communications Inc (LORL)

Loral Space & Communications Inc (TO:LORL) has a market capitalization of $9.61 Billion (CA$13.81 Billion) as of March 19, 2026. Listed on the TO stock exchange, this Canada-based company holds position #2936 globally and #7 in its home market, demonstrating a 0.00% increase in market value over the past year.

Market capitalization, also known as net worth in stock markets, is calculated by multiplying Loral Space & Communications Inc's stock price CA$25.87 by its total outstanding shares 533783024 (533.78 Million).

Loral Space & Communications Inc Market Cap History: 2025 to 2026

Loral Space & Communications Inc's market capitalization history from 2025 to 2026. Data shows growth from $8.99 Billion to $9.61 Billion (0.00% CAGR).

Loral Space & Communications Inc Market Cap to Earnings & Revenue Ratios Timeline

This chart shows how Loral Space & Communications Inc's valuation ratios have evolved. The Price to Sales (P/S) ratio compares market cap to revenue, while the Price to Earnings (P/E) ratio compares market cap to net income. Lower values may indicate a more undervalued company relative to its financial performance.

Latest Price to Sales (P/S) Ratio

0.20x

Loral Space & Communications Inc's market cap is 0.20 times its annual revenue

Industry average:
0.11x
Higher than industry average

Latest Price to Earnings (P/E) Ratio

1.47x

Loral Space & Communications Inc's market cap is 1.47 times its annual earnings

Industry average:
0.85x
Higher than industry average
What These Ratios Tell Investors:
  • Price to Sales (P/S) Ratio: Shows how much investors are paying for each dollar of the company's sales. Lower P/S ratios may indicate undervaluation.
  • Price to Earnings (P/E) Ratio: Shows how much investors are paying for each dollar of the company's earnings. This is one of the most common valuation metrics.
  • Trends in these ratios over time can indicate changing investor sentiment about the company's future growth prospects.
  • Industry comparison provides context for whether the company is valued higher or lower than peers.
Year Market Cap (USD) Revenue (USD) Net Income (USD) P/S Ratio P/E Ratio
2025 $8.99 Billion $44.05 Billion $6.13 Billion 0.20x 1.47x

Competitor Companies of LORL by Market Capitalization

Companies near Loral Space & Communications Inc in the global market cap rankings as of March 19, 2026.

Key companies related to Loral Space & Communications Inc by market ranking:

  • Procter & Gamble Company (NYSE:PG): Ranked #35 globally with a market cap of $351.41 Billion USD.
  • Unilever PLC (PINK:UNLYF): Ranked #141 globally with a market cap of $131.81 Billion USD.
  • UNILEVER PLC LS -,035 (XETRA:UNV0): Ranked #147 globally with a market cap of $126.11 Billion USD ( €122.86 Billion EUR).
  • L'Oréal S.A (PINK:LRLCF): Ranked #215 globally with a market cap of $94.58 Billion USD.

Market capitalization comparison (in billions USD)
Rank Company Symbol Market Cap Price
#35 Procter & Gamble Company NYSE:PG $351.41 Billion $151.48
#141 Unilever PLC PINK:UNLYF $131.81 Billion $60.96
#147 UNILEVER PLC LS -,035 XETRA:UNV0 $126.11 Billion €56.81
#215 L'Oréal S.A PINK:LRLCF $94.58 Billion $368.10

Loral Space & Communications Inc Historical Marketcap From 2025 to 2026

Between 2025 and today, Loral Space & Communications Inc's market cap moved from $8.99 Billion to $ 9.61 Billion, with a yearly change of 0.00%.

Year Market Cap Change (%)
2026 CA$9.61 Billion +6.90%
2025 CA$8.99 Billion --

End of Day Market Cap According to Different Sources

On Mar 18th, 2026 the market cap of Loral Space & Communications Inc was reported to be:

Source Market Cap
Yahoo Finance $9.61 Billion USD
MoneyControl $9.61 Billion USD
MarketWatch $9.61 Billion USD
marketcap.company $9.61 Billion USD
Reuters $9.61 Billion USD

Market cap values may vary slightly between sources due to differences in calculation methods, timing, and data refresh rates.